    According to our (Global Info Research) latest study, the global Fully Automatic Pipetting Robot market size was valued at US$ 916 million in 2025 and is forecast to a readjusted size of US$ 1411 million by 2032 with a CAGR of 6.3% during review period.
    In 2025, global Fully Automatic Pipetting Robot production reached approximately 7,416 units with an average global market price of around k US$120 per unit. Single-line annual production capacity averages 150 units with a gross margin of approximately 31%. The upstream of the Fully Automatic Pipetting Robot industry is primarily composed of core components such as precision mechanics, control systems, and sensors, which are concentrated in the field of precision instrument manufacturing. The downstream applications are extensive, with biopharmaceutical companies accounting for about 50%, medical institutions for approximately 30%, universities and research institutions for about 20%, and other fields for about 10%. As life science research deepens, there is a sustained increase in the demand for Fully Automatic Pipetting Robots, and the business opportunity lies in technological innovation and the provision of customized solutions to meet the diverse needs of various application scenarios.
    The Fully Automatic Pipetting Robot represents a pinnacle of precision and efficiency in liquid handling technology, capable of executing a wide array of tasks from pipetting to dispensing and mixing with minimal human intervention. This robot is designed to streamline laboratory workflows, reducing the potential for human error and allowing for the consistent and reliable processing of large volumes of samples. By integrating advanced control systems and user-friendly interfaces, it ensures seamless operation, enhancing productivity and enabling researchers to focus on more critical aspects of their experiments.
    The Fully Automatic Pipetting Robot industry is poised for a future marked by significant advancements in intelligence and multifunctionality. With technological progress, these robots are expected to become smaller, more portable, and capable of handling smaller sample volumes with high precision and adaptability. Equipped with advanced control systems and user-friendly interfaces, they will be able to perform a range of liquid handling tasks such as mixing, dispensing, and centrifuging, all while enhancing the flexibility and efficiency of laboratory work through wireless communication and remote control. As customization services increase and costs decrease, Fully Automatic Pipetting Robots will become more widespread, featuring rigorous biosecurity features to prevent cross-contamination. Furthermore, with integration into Laboratory Information Management Systems (LIMS), these robots will provide real-time data analysis and reporting, propelling the advancement of digital laboratory management.
